China has made it a nationwide precedence to meet up with SpaceX’s practically 8,000 Starlink internet-providing satellites in low-Earth orbit, which it regards as a navy risk. Regardless of successes in different components of its house program, China has simply 124 internet-providing satellites in low-Earth orbit. Selam Gebrekidian, an investigative reporter for The New York Occasions, explains why China is lagging behind on this new house race.
